1. What is Crystalline Fructose?
Crystalline fructose is a white, crystalline powder that is derived from corn syrup through a series of processing steps. It is composed of pure fructose, a simple sugar found in fruits and honey. Due to its high sweetness level, crystalline fructose is commonly used as a sweetening agent in various food and beverage products.
2. Applications in the Pharmaceutical and Healthcare Industry:
In the pharmaceutical and healthcare sector, crystalline fructose finds applications beyond its sweetening properties. It is often utilized as a pharmaceutical excipient, offering several advantages such as its ability to enhance taste, improve stability, and act as a bulking agent in tablet formulations.
Moreover, crystalline fructose is being explored for its potential use in oral rehydration solutions, which play a crucial role in replenishing fluids and electrolytes in patients suffering from dehydration. Its solubility and sweetness make it an ideal ingredient for such formulations.
3. Potential Health Benefits:
While the primary focus of crystalline fructose lies in its functional properties, it also offers potential health benefits. It has a lower glycemic index compared to other sweeteners and does not cause a rapid spike in blood sugar levels. This characteristic makes it a viable alternative for individuals with diabetes or those seeking to manage their blood sugar levels.
Additionally, studies have suggested that fructose, in moderate quantities, may support liver health, provide sustained energy release, and offer antioxidant properties. However, it is essential to consume crystalline fructose in moderation as excessive intake of any sweetener, including fructose, may lead to adverse health effects.
